The Railway Reform Authority proposes the elaboration of a study on the sustainability and efficiency of the rail network in Romania, establishing as a general objective a comprehensive analysis of the efficiency of the rail network in Romania, including cost-benefit analyses for railway lines. At the basis of the establishment of the secondary network (non-interoperable), the Railway Reform Authority received technical assistance from EIB Passa experts. Also, during the procedure for the purchase of rolling stock, as part of the railway reform package, cost-benefit analyses of the (interoperable) primary rail network in Romania will be carried out, as presented by the MGPT and which will be the basis for identifying the main needs of the rolling stock market in Romania, the technical requirements of the future purchase of rolling stock depending on the life cycle and maintenance costs, the organisation of tenders for public service contracts and the procurement of rolling stock. The analyses carried out for interoperable lines, together with those carried out for non-interoperable lines, will form the basis for the elaboration of the sustainability analysis at the level of the entire railway network in Romania in order to restructure the rail transport network, in the sense of focusing on an efficient transport network.
